Brady Earnhart
Brady Earnhart

Originally from Delray Beach, FL, Brady has performed to small, attentive audiences across the U.S. His song "Gargoyle" won the gold medal in the folk category of the 2002 Mid-Atlantic Songwriting Contest, and his "Goodnight, Friday Night" was voted one of the top ten songs at the 2002 Mountain Stage New Song Festival. His CD "Manalapan" was a finalist in the 2004 Outmusic Awards, losing only to Rufus Wainwright's "Want One." Brady has also been proud to hear his song "Car Repair" aired on NPR's CarTalk. He holds an MFA in Creative Writing from the University of Iowa and a PhD in American Literature from UVA. In addition to songwriting and performing, he has taught creative writing in upstate New York schools, English as a Second Language in Spain, and (currently) American Literature at The University of Mary Washington in Fredericksburg, VA.
